[Bug 1018905] Review Request: scap-security-guide - Security guidance and baselines in SCAP formats

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



https://bugzilla.redhat.com/show_bug.cgi?id=1018905

Zbigniew Jędrzejewski-Szmek <zbyszek@xxxxxxxxx> changed:

           What    |Removed                     |Added
----------------------------------------------------------------------------
                 CC|                            |zbyszek@xxxxxxxxx
           Assignee|nobody@xxxxxxxxxxxxxxxxx    |zbyszek@xxxxxxxxx
              Flags|                            |fedora-review?



--- Comment #4 from Zbigniew Jędrzejewski-Szmek <zbyszek@xxxxxxxxx> ---
BuildRoot is not needed.
Rerequires: filesystem, coreutils, is also not needed.

"The scap-security-guide project provides security configuration guidance in
formats of the Security Content Automation Protocol": this sentence is somehow
grammatically incorrect.

Gzipping of manpages will be done automatically, just copy it into the right
place. If the compression method changes, spec will not have to be adjusted.

Drop the chcon. Every package I have seen installs man pages without this.

Drop %clean.

Change .gz to *. in %files, so that it works if the compression changes.

Fedora 19 version is hardcoded in various places. Is the package really so
version specific, that it must be specific for each version of Fedora? You most
certainly want to build this for F20 and rawhide too...

Source refers to your personal page. Why can't you use an "real" URL like
https://git.fedorahosted.org/cgit/scap-security-guide.git/snapshot/scap-security-guide-d478d863b4166d105dbdd1b577d27edb3f847a86.tar.bz2?
This has the advantage that it's easier to see the origin of sources.

Please add LICENSE to %files.

Directories without known owners: /usr/share/xml/scap/ssg/fedora,
     /usr/share/xml, /usr/share/xml/scap, /usr/share/xml/scap/ssg/fedora/19,
     /usr/share/xml/scap/ssg

Hm, binary package requires openscap-utils, which in turn requires openscap,
totalling 2.8 MB. Why does this requirement exist?

-- 
You are receiving this mail because:
You are on the CC list for the bug.
_______________________________________________
package-review mailing list
package-review@xxxxxxxxxxxxxxxxxxxxxxx
https://admin.fedoraproject.org/mailman/listinfo/package-review





[Index of Archives]     [Fedora Legacy]     [Fedora Desktop]     [Fedora SELinux]     [Yosemite News]     [KDE Users]     [Fedora Tools]